News Topical, Digital Desk : Thanks to the efforts of the Yogi government, women involved in the dairy sector are reaping double benefits. Women who have become members/shareholders of the Shri Baba Gorakhnath Kripa Milk Producers Organization, formed under the Uttar Pradesh State Rural Livelihood Mission, have not only strengthened their livelihoods but are also now able to meet their household fuel needs free of charge.
As part of a pilot project, this MPO, in collaboration with the National Dairy Development Board, has initially installed domestic biogas plants in the homes of 100 female members. As a result, these women are now cooking with cow dung gas. The plant's residue is used as organic fertilizer for agriculture. The MPO's goal is to install a domestic biogas plant in every female member's home.

The Shri Baba Gorakhnath Kripa Milk Producers Organization was formed under the vision of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ath. Recognizing the remarkable contributions made by women associated with Bundelkhand's Balini Milk Producers Company, formed in 2019, to the dairy sector and the story of women's self-reliance being written through it, CM Yogi directed the creation of Milk Producers Organizations (MPOs) with women's participation in other sectors as well. In this regard, the Shri Baba Gorakhnath Kripa MPO was formed in Gorakhpur by the State Rural Livelihood Mission in collaboration with the National Dairy Development Board.

Through this MPO, which became operational about two and a half years ago, over 51,000 rural homemakers in eastern Uttar Pradesh have embarked on a path to economic independence by joining the dairy sector. These women are strengthening their families' economies by engaging in milk production/collection while also managing household chores.
Dhanraj Sahni, Chief Executive Officer (CEO) of MPO, explains that in a short time, thanks to the hard work of the women members, MPO's turnover has reached nearly 200 crore rupees. MPO has now launched a pilot project to provide dual benefits to its member women. To date, 100 domestic biogas plants have been successfully installed behind member homes. The MPO CEO explains that this initiative is proving to be an effective source of clean energy, additional savings, and sustainable income for rural families.
Biogas produced from animal dung is available day and night, ensuring continuous access to cooking gas for families. This significantly reduces fuel costs. Furthermore, the organic slurry (manure) produced from the biogas plant is extremely useful for agricultural use, reducing dependence on chemical fertilizers and saving on farming costs. This initiative is not only improving the living standards of rural women but also making a significant contribution to environmental protection.

The women members of the MPO are extremely excited by this initiative. Rajkumari Devi, a resident of Rakhi in the Bharohia block, says that the biogas plant provides her with dual benefits: clean energy, time savings, reduced cooking expenses, and additional organic fertilizer. Roshni Yadav of Parsia village in the Gola area says that joining the MPO and collecting milk has increased her income, and the biogas plant is now easily meeting her household's energy needs for the kitchen.
